Sanyo flashes new DMX-CG100 and DMX-GH1 Full HD Video Cameras

Xacti Video Cameras

On the prowl for a super-stylish digital video camera with a slew of innovative attributes? Call a halt! Sanyo has just introduced its new Xacti Series of video cameras with two models – the DMX-CG100 and DMX-GH1.

Enshrouded in slim and compact designs, the new models capture Full HD video and high-definition photos, based on the Dual Camera concept of taking both videos and photos with one camera. The Xacti series are designed to be portable, making it easy for users to conveniently carry it anywhere, anytime.

By taking advantage of a convenient video format that can be easily handheld on PC and Internet environments, as well as on home TVs, the devices are perfect for capturing, viewing and saving images. Both the cameras can capably capture Full HD video (1920 x 1080 (60i)) and 14 mega-pixel high-resolution photos.

Besides, the DMX-CG100 and DMX-GH1 integrate Sanyo’s proprietary Double Range Zoom feature for zoom operation while filming video. With this equipped technology, users can now effectively switch between two zoom ranges, a Wide Mode and a Tele Mode, which changes the size of the video capture area on the image sensor.

Other salient features include Digital Image Stabilizer and Face Chaser Function for videos, Reverse Sequential Shot Function to prevent the missing of photo opportunities, Mini HDMI Terminal for the enjoyment of even more beautiful Full HD resolution, and Eye-Fi card compatibility for automatic uploading of images to a computer.

The new Sanyo Xacti Series of video cameras is anticipated to be available on April 16, 2010. The pricing details are yet to be announced.
